Organised in conjunction with The Artist and Leisure Painter magazines, the open competition has become a major opportunity internationally for both amateur and professional artists.
The exhibition promises high quality with 70 works from each category exhibited in both galleries and a further 50 highly-commended from each category on the Patchings website
